Bob Ellis

August 21, 1961 — April 3, 2021

Robert “Bob” Joseph Ellis, 59, of Wilson, passed away peacefully Saturday, April 3, 2021.

Due to the COVID-19 pandemic, family will not be receiving visitors but will have a celebration of life at a later date.

Bob was born and educated in Wilson.  He graduated from Fike High School and after graduation attended The Sound School of Music in Chillicothe, Ohio.  He learned the art of music and directed the sound for several bands after his graduation.  After his music career, he became a truck driver and traveled all over the United States as a long haul trucker.  Ultimately he ended his trucking career with local trucking companies in Panama City Beach, Florida and Wilson, NC.

Bob will be remembered as a strong-willed, adventurous father, brother and son.
